Polarisation-dependent NEXAFS data are presented for the reaction inte
rmediate C4H4 chemisorbed on Pd(III). Comparison of these data with ca
lculated spectra indicates that this species is a metallocycle with sl
ightly expanded (approximately 0.05 angstrom) C-C bonds. Dependence of
the resonance intensities on photon incidence angle shows that the mo
lecular plane is tilted at approximately 35-degrees with respect to th
e metal surface. The assigned chemical identity and absorption geometr
y are fully consistent with all the reactive behaviour of C4H4.
